Correspondence between Lord Byron and John Cam Hobhouse., 1808-1824.
John Cam Hobhouse was the closest friend of Lord Byron. Having met at Cambridge, they remained in close contact until the poet died in 1824. The letters of Byron to Hobhouse provide important insights into their friendship, lives and works, as well as information relating to the wider Byron circle.

Galley proof of 'The Vision of Judgment', by Lord Byron under the pseudonym 'Quevedo Redivivus'., ? 1822.
‘Vision of Judgment’ by Byron was published by John Hunt in 1822. Byron had written the poem in 1821 and previously offered the poem to John Murray [II], who refused to publish it.
There are here two folios of galley proofs of 'Vision of Judgment' and give the author as the pseudonym 'Quevedo Redivivus'.
